chicagotribune.com: "GETTING THERE Antigua lies in the middle of the Lesser Antilles in the West Indies, on the northeastern edge of the Caribbean archipelago. Antigua and the much smaller island of Barbuda form a dual island nation. V.C. Bird International Airport, the island's only airport, is about 5 miles northeast of the capital, St. John's; there are no non-stop flights from Chicago. Mid-May round-trips on a single carrier from O'Hare run about $800, though sporadic deals bring the price tag down to $515."
